Subject: Telemetry compression handoff

Hey — quick heads-up: I'm handing off the payload compression work on Driftware telemetry. The zstd switch ships with the next train; dictionary tuning is still open. Nothing blocking the release, just flag it in the notes. Going forward, all compression questions go to the person named below.

signatory, kaweg-fawig: Zorys Druys Jorius Novael

ParityHawk continuously compares room rates for the Bellmare Hotels group across distribution channels and flags mismatches. Before restarting the service, confirm that the crawler queue in the Ostvik region is drained; restarting mid-crawl can duplicate comparison jobs and trigger false parity alerts. Note for security review: the checker holds read-only channel credentials, rotated weekly, and all outbound requests pass through the Harrowgate egress proxy. Once the queue is empty, restart with the configuration shown below.

service settings:
[casax]
port = 6379
team = rusir
host = casax.zemvarhq.corp
region = outer-4
access_code = ac_9808ce
timeout_ms = 1500

## Authentication

The Larkspur load-test harness hits the Mossbridge checkout flow on staging only. Each virtual user authenticates once at ramp-up and reuses its session for the full run; no per-request login, so auth service load stays flat. For the weekly sync: note that token refresh is disabled during runs longer than 30 minutes, which skews error counts. The harness itself authenticates to the orchestrator using the bearer token below.

session JWT of yawep-yawep = eyJhbGciOiJIUzI1NiIsInR5cCI6IkpXVCJ9.eyJzdWIiOiI3pWF3_In0.aXYsHiog